What happened: The Saints' account reacted with a goat emoji to a stat post ranking the decade's passing leaders, which shows Drew Brees atop the 2010s with 46,770 yards. Matt Ryan (44,830) and Philip Rivers (44,320) round out the top three, with Tom Brady (43,727) fourth.

Why it matters: The figures cap Brees' run as the decade's most prolific passer for New Orleans, a mark that underscores the franchise's passing-era identity through the 2010s.

By the numbers: 2010s passing yards: Brees 46,770, Ryan 44,830, Rivers 44,320, Brady 43,727, Stafford 38,758, Manning 38,379, Rodgers 38,145.
